.post-card{border:var(--border);background:var(--color-bg-2)}.post-card a{color:initial;text-decoration:none}.post-card .pc-media a{display:block}.post-card .pc-content{margin-top:1em;display:grid;gap:.75em}.post-card .pc-content h2{margin:0 1em;font-size:1.1em;letter-spacing:0;line-height:1.5em}.post-card .pc-content h2 a{font-weight:700}.post-card .pc-content .pc-text{font-size:.85em;margin:0 1em;line-height:1.5em}.post-card .pc-content .pc-attributes .meta{margin:0 1em .5em;font-size:.8em;line-height:1.5em;color:var(--color-grey)}.post-card .pc-content .pc-attributes .button-post-interactions{padding-left:1em;padding-right:1em}.event-card{border:var(--border);background:var(--color-bg-2)}.event-card a{color:initial;text-decoration:none}.event-card .ec-media a{display:block}.event-card .ec-content{margin-top:1em;display:grid;gap:.75em}.event-card .ec-content h2{margin:0 1em;font-size:1.1em;letter-spacing:0;line-height:1.5em}.event-card .ec-content h2 a{font-weight:700}.event-card .ec-content .ec-text{font-size:.85em;margin:0 1em;line-height:1.5em}.event-card .ec-content .ec-attributes .meta{margin:0 1em .5em;font-size:.8em;line-height:1.5em;color:var(--color-grey)}.event-card .ec-content .ec-attributes .button-post-interactions{padding-left:1em;padding-right:1em}.event-card+.event-card,.event-card+.post-card,.post-card+.event-card,.post-card+.post-card{margin-top:1.5em}.pin-post a{display:block;padding:1em 0;color:initial;text-decoration:none}.pin-post h3{font-size:1em;letter-spacing:0;line-height:1.3em}.pin-post+.pin-post{border-top:var(--border-dotted)}.pin-event a{gap:1em;display:grid;grid-template-columns:1fr 2fr;align-items:center;text-decoration:none;color:initial;margin:.5em 0}.pin-event .startDate{background:var(--color-bg-2);text-align:center;padding:1em;border-radius:var(--radius)}.pin-event .startDate strong{font-size:2em;line-height:1em;display:block}.pin-event .startDate span{font-weight:700}.pin-event .content h3{font-size:1em}.pin-event+.pin-event{border-top:var(--border-dotted)}#feed-right{margin-top:3em}#feed-right h2{text-transform:uppercase;color:var(--color-grey);margin-bottom:1em;font-size:1.2em;letter-spacing:0}#feed-right h2 svg{height:15px;width:15px;display:inline-block;margin-right:.5em}#service-group h1 small{display:inline-block;font-size:.6em;font-weight:400;letter-spacing:0}#service-group .service-group-list{display:grid;gap:1em}#service-group .service{background:var(--color-bg-2);border-radius:var(--radius);text-decoration:none;color:initial;text-align:center}#service-group .service .sr-only{display:none}#service-group .service .service-name{padding:1em .75em .75em;font-weight:700}#service-group .service .service-description{padding:0 .75em .75em;color:var(--color-grey);font-size:.85em}.post-detail .post-attributes{font-size:.85em;color:var(--color-grey);margin-bottom:1em}.post-detail .post-attributes .attr-date time{display:block}.post-detail .post-attributes .attr-date time svg{width:15px;height:15px}.post-detail .post-attributes .attr-author{margin-top:.5em}.search-box .search-box-wrapper{display:flex;border:var(--border);background:var(--color-bg-2);gap:1em}.search-box .search-box-wrapper .icon{flex-shrink:0;padding:.65em .5em .5em 1em}.search-box .search-box-wrapper .icon svg{width:20px;color:var(--color-grey)}.search-box .search-box-wrapper input{flex:1;border:none;background:none}.search-box .search-box-wrapper input:focus-visible{outline:2px solid var(--color-link);outline-offset:-2px}@media (min-width:768px){.post-card{display:grid;grid-template-columns:1fr 1fr}.post-card .media-wrapper{height:100%}.post-card.no-cover{display:block}.event-card{display:grid;grid-template-columns:1fr 1fr}.event-card .media-wrapper{height:100%}.event-card.no-cover{display:block}#service-group .service-group-list,.post-detail .post-attributes{grid-template-columns:repeat(2,1fr)}.post-detail .post-attributes{display:grid;gap:1em;align-items:end}.post-detail .post-attributes .attr-date time{text-align:right}.post-detail .post-attributes .attr-author span{display:block}.post-detail .pd-content .content-aside{margin-top:2em}}@media (min-width:992px){.pin-event h3,.pin-post h3,.post-card .pc-content a{transition:color .3s}.pin-event:hover h3,.pin-post:hover h3,.post-card:hover .pc-content a{color:var(--color-link)}#post-feed{display:grid;grid-template-columns:3fr 1fr;gap:2em}#feed-right{margin-top:0;position:relative}#feed-right .fr_container{position:sticky;top:10em}#service-group .service-group-list{grid-template-columns:repeat(3,1fr)}.post-detail .pd-content{display:grid;grid-template-columns:5fr 2fr;gap:2em}.post-detail .pd-content .content-aside{margin-top:0}.post-detail .pd-content .content-aside h2{font-size:1.3em;letter-spacing:-1px;display:flex;gap:.5em;margin-bottom:1em}.service-group .services{grid-template-columns:repeat(3,1fr)}.service-group .services .service-name{font-size:1em}.service-header .serviceName{padding-right:1em}}@media (min-width:1200px){.post-card{grid-template-columns:6fr 6fr;align-items:stretch}.post-card .pc-content{display:flex;flex-direction:column;height:100%;margin-top:0;padding-top:1.5em}.post-card .pc-content h2{margin:0 1.75em}.post-card .pc-content .pc-text{margin:0 2em;flex:1}.post-card .pc-content .pc-attributes{margin:0}.post-card .pc-content .pc-attributes .meta{margin:0 2em .5em}.post-card .pc-content .pc-attributes .button-post-interactions{padding-left:2em;padding-right:2em}.event-card{grid-template-columns:6fr 6fr;align-items:stretch}.event-card .ec-content{display:flex;flex-direction:column;height:100%;margin-top:0;padding-top:1.5em}.event-card .ec-content h2{margin:0 1.75em}.event-card .ec-content .ec-text{margin:0 2em;flex:1}.event-card .ec-content .ec-attributes{margin:0}.event-card .ec-content .ec-attributes .meta{margin:0 2em .5em}.event-card .ec-content .ec-attributes .button-post-interactions{padding-left:2em;padding-right:2em}#service-group .service-group-list{grid-template-columns:repeat(4,1fr)}.post-detail .pd-content{gap:3em}.service-group .services{gap:1.5em;grid-template-columns:repeat(4,1fr)}}